Fished the banks on Thursday, later start getting a line in the water at 830. Slow bite all day,which we expected. Varible winds made anchoring tough.There was bugger all run, Still managed a good feed and some dog food. Couple of good snapper including a few gold band.The spangled went 80cm.Great day on the water 27knts all the way home back at the ramp at 430.

What sort of depth are you anchoring in? I've never anchored in more than 50m.
How much rope do you let out in that depth? I'm guessing you have a winch.
Hey mate, retrieval is by float. In 80m I would have about 120m of rope out.
